Apprenticeship Programmes

Dáil Éireann Debate, Tuesday - 15 June 2021

Tuesday, 15 June 2021

Ceisteanna (1068)

Seán Canney

Ceist:

1068. Deputy Seán Canney asked the Minister for Further and Higher Education, Research, Innovation and Science if his attention has been drawn to the fact that Solas is no longer running the apprenticeship course in the craft of floor and wall tiling;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[31684/21]

Amharc ar fhreagra

Freagraí scríofa

Apprenticeship is a demand driven educational and training programme which aims to develop the skills of an apprentice in order to meet the needs of industry and the labour market. Consequently, the number of apprentices being registered is determined by employers in the sector.

Unfortunately, the tiling apprenticeship has been closed for registrations for a number of years due to low registrations. However, floor and wall tiling is included as a module in the Plastering Apprenticeship. More information in relation to this apprenticeship and the other 60 apprenticeships which are currently available can found on www.apprenticeship.ie.
